Overview

Coach is an American luxury fashion house known for its craftsmanship in leather goods and accessories. The brand is part of Tapestry, a global house of modern luxury fashion brands, and operates an international network of flagship stores and concessions. As an employer, Coach emphasizes product expertise, elevated client service and opportunities for professional development within a global retail organisation.

Role & Responsibilities

  • Deliver exceptional, personalised client service and cultivate long-term relationships through proactive clienteling and follow-up.
  • Drive individual and store sales performance, meet KPIs and contribute to visual merchandising and store presentation standards.
  • Maintain up-to-date product knowledge across categories and communicate brand heritage and craftsmanship to clients.
  • Process transactions accurately using the point-of-sale system; handle cash, payments and refunds in accordance with policy.
  • Support inventory management including stock replenishment, receiving, cycle counts and loss-prevention procedures.
  • Participate in store events, private client appointments and promotional initiatives to maximise client acquisition and retention.
  • Collaborate with colleagues and leadership to execute store priorities and maintain a professional retail environment.

Qualifications

  • Proven retail sales experience, preferably 2+ years within luxury or premium brands.
  • Demonstrable track record of meeting or exceeding sales targets and KPIs.
  • Polished interpersonal skills with a customer-first mindset and strong clienteling ability.
  • Flexible availability including weekends, evenings and holiday periods.
  • Professional presentation and strong attention to detail.
